Lawn aeration and over seeding is recognized by lawn and turf experts such as golf course groundskeepers as the best treatment to control thatch, reduce compaction, fill-in bare spots and revitalize the growth of your lawn.
Lawn aeration is important if your lawn has heavy foot traffic.
This process removes small cores of soil and thatch to allow air, moisture and fertilizer to penetrate down to the root zone.
The cores brought to the surface contain micro-organisms, which help the breakdown of the thatch tissue.
This allows the roots of existing grass plants to spread out and grow deeper, creating a healthier, thicker lawn.
Over seeding in cool-season areas, will fill-in bare or thin spots and help build a thicker lawn faster.
The new seed quickly takes root in the freshly aerated lawn and provides new life to your already established grass.
As your lawn gets thicker and healthier, your new grass plants help reduce the chance of new weeds sprouting.
Lawn aeration can be done anytime the lawn is actively growing. In the south, the preferred season is late spring. In the north, early fall is the time to aerate.
